Royals take high school shortstop

By: AP
Posted: Fri 10:38 AM, Jun 08, 2007

KANSAS CITY, Mo. (AP) -- The Kansas City Royals took Mike
Moustakas, a power-hitting high school shortstop from California,
with the overall number two pick today in the baseball draft.
Moustakas is six-feet tall and weighs 195 pounds. He hit .577
with 24 home runs for Chatsworth High School and was named the Los
Angeles City player of the year.
His fastball has been clocked at 97 miles per hour. But the
Royals said they have no intention of playing him anywhere but
shortstop.
Moustakas was taken right after Tampa selected Valderbilt
pitcher David Price as the top pick.
